More people have lost their lives in India in road accidents than in wars, militancy and Naxalism, Union Minister for Road Transport and Highways Nitin Gadkari said on Wednesday.

Addressing the sixth edition of FICCI Road Safety Awards and Conclave 2024, Gadkari added that the number of black spots is increasing due to poor detailed project reports (DPR) of road projects.

“More people have lost their lives in road accidents than in wars, militancy and Naxalism,” he said.

According to Gadkari, 500,000 accidents and 150,000 deaths occur in India every year, while 300,000 people are injured.

“This has resulted in a 3% loss of the country’s GDP. As if it were a scapegoat, a driver is blamed for every accident. Let me tell you, and I look at this carefully, that road engineering is often to blame,” he said.

The Minister stressed the need to conduct safety audits on all roads.

He also noted that in order to reduce the number of accidents, “it is necessary to maintain lane discipline.”

Gadkari added that the Ministry of Road Transport and Highways is preparing codes for ambulances and their drivers to train them in using sophisticated machinery like cutters to quickly rescue victims of road accidents.
